I'm a new user. This is a fresh install. It crashes when I load/select an XDF. I've tried a a few XDFs directly off the TunerPro website.
TunerPro Build 5.00.10044.00
Windows 10.0.19045 Build 19045 (all updated)
No dll's in the plugins folder.
The windows logs show errors at the time of the crash related to MsftEdit.dll and xmllite.dll. SFC reports no issues with those files.

Found a fix, but I have no idea why this works....
Opening XDFs from the downloads folders causes a crash. However if I move them to the BIN Definitions folder... no more crashes. I've never experienced that before with other software.
